Course Outline
Module 1: Exam Blueprint & Preparation Strategy
- Detailed overview of the exam domains and their respective weightings for the AWS Certified Solutions Architect certification
- Developing a structured study plan, selecting resources, and managing time effectively for focused preparation
- Effective test-taking strategies, including scenario analysis, eliminating distractors, and time management
Module 2: Designing Resilient Architectures
- Architecting multi-AZ and multi-region solutions to ensure high availability
- Understanding failure modes, Recovery Time Objectives (RTO), Recovery Point Objectives (RPO), and automated recovery patterns
- Practical scenario: Designing a fault-tolerant web application architecture
Module 3: Designing High-Performing Architectures
- Selecting appropriate compute and storage services for performance and scalability (e.g., EC2, Lambda, EBS, S3, EFS)
- Implementing caching strategies, using Content Delivery Networks (CloudFront), and optimizing database performance
- Practical scenario: Designing systems for scale and low latency
Module 4: Designing Secure Applications and Architectures
- Best practices for Identity and Access Management (IAM), including roles, policies, and Security Token Service (STS)
- Network security configurations (VPC, subnets, security groups, NACLs) and encryption strategies using KMS
- Practical scenario: Securing an application stack from end to end
Module 5: Designing Cost-Optimized and Operationally Excellent Architectures
- Techniques for cost optimization, such as right-sizing instances, utilizing savings plans, and managing lifecycle policies
- Achieving operational excellence through monitoring, logging, CloudWatch, CloudTrail, and automation
- Practical scenario: Implementing cost controls and creating operational runbooks
Module 6: Integration, Databases, and Migration Patterns
- Selecting managed services for data and integration needs (RDS, Aurora, DynamoDB, SQS, SNS, EventBridge)
- Strategies for data migration and hybrid connectivity (DMS, DataSync, Direct Connect, VPN)
- Case study: Choosing the appropriate data architecture to meet specific business requirements
Module 7: Practice Exams and Question Walkthroughs
- Taking a timed practice exam that covers all exam domains
- In-depth review of selected questions, identifying common pitfalls and errors
- Receiving individual feedback and actionable items for continued study
Module 8: Capstone Design Workshop
- Group exercise: Designing a comprehensive solution for a sample enterprise use case
- Creating architecture diagrams, justifying service selections, and presenting design trade-offs
- Peer review and instructor critique aligned with Well-Architected principles

Requirements
- A solid understanding of cloud fundamentals and networking principles
- Practical experience with core AWS services, including compute, storage, and networking
- Basic familiarity with security concepts and Identity and Access Management (IAM)
Target Audience
- Cloud engineers preparing for the AWS Certified Solutions Architect certification
- Solutions architects seeking structured practice and exam preparation
- Technical leads and consultants looking to validate and enhance their cloud design knowledge
